To break it down:

 

Streaming: Average number one recently has about 4.5 to 5 million. The half life of One Dance (from peak of ~9M to ~4.5M) was about 10 weeks. If Shape of You decays at the same rate it'll be hitting 6.5M in about the same time, which now equates to 45K in chart money.

 

Sales: Here I think Hello is the closest comparison - it decayed to 20% over 5 weeks. That would be about 25K.

 

Combined sales: Using the above Shape of You would have ~50K after 10 weeks. That is on the cusp - the lowest number one combined sales recently was 59K but 70-80 is more usual.

 

A lot might depend on whether the album release gives the song a boost - personally I don't think it will be significant. More interesting, perhaps is how long Ed can monopolise the number one (as Bieber did) with tracks from the album. Could he get to Easter? Seems possible.
